Coinbase (COIN) stock rallied 8% after Goldman Sachs upgraded the shares to “Buy” and raised its price target to $303, citing strong growth prospects across crypto infrastructure, tokenization, and prediction markets.

Summary

Coinbase (COIN) stock rallied 8% after Goldman Sachs upgraded the shares to “Buy” and raised its price target to $303, citing strong growth prospects across crypto infrastructure, tokenization, and prediction markets.

What Goldman Sachs Highlighted

  • Crypto infrastructure expansion
    Coinbase is increasingly positioned as a core platform for custody, trading, settlement, and compliance.
  • Tokenization tailwinds
    Growth in tokenized assets and on‑chain settlement could drive higher institutional usage and fee generation.
  • Prediction markets opportunity
    New market categories may add incremental revenue streams beyond spot trading.

Goldman’s upgrade reflects confidence in Coinbase’s ability to diversify beyond transaction‑driven revenue.

Why the Market Reacted Strongly

  • Validation from a top investment bank
  • Improved outlook for long‑term, recurring revenues
  • Re‑rating potential as Coinbase evolves into a crypto financial infrastructure company, not just an exchange

The move suggests investors are increasingly pricing Coinbase as a platform business rather than a cyclical trading play.

The US Securities and Exchange Commission has approved generic listing standards for exchange-traded products (ETPs) that hold spot commodities, including crypto assets. National securities exchanges such as Nasdaq, Cboe BZX, and NYSE Arca can now list spot crypto ETFs without seeking case-by-case SEC approval, provided they meet the generic requirements. But according to Bitwise CEO Hunter Horsley, the next big shift might not come from these areas, but it could come from crypto credit and borrowing. Speaking on the evolving role of digital assets in traditional capital markets, Horsley projected that credit markets built on crypto and tokenized assets will see explosive growth in the next few years. He also suggested that this transformation could come through within the next 6-12 months and it will reshape how crypto market works. Bitwise CEO talks about the next big thing in crypto The Two Vectors of Growth Horsley in his post on X (formerly known as Twitter) highlighted two major forces that might be converging in the near future: The first reason is the size of the crypto market. As of now, there’s almost $4 trillion worth of cryptocurrency in circulation worldwide and as we can see the number is growing day by day. Due to this growth, many investors do not want to sell their coins, but they still need cash sometimes. According to the Bitwise CEO, borrowing against crypto makes more sense because instead of selling coins, people can instead use them as collateral for loans.
